فهرست مطالب:

اندازه گیری الکتریسیته ساکن سیستم روشنایی اضطراری: 8 مرحله
اندازه گیری الکتریسیته ساکن سیستم روشنایی اضطراری: 8 مرحله

تصویری: اندازه گیری الکتریسیته ساکن سیستم روشنایی اضطراری: 8 مرحله

تصویری: اندازه گیری الکتریسیته ساکن سیستم روشنایی اضطراری: 8 مرحله
تصویری: دستگاه گوارش بدن ما چگونه غذا را به مدفوع تبدیل میکند|انیمیشنهای پزشکی را در کانال قاصدک ببینید 2024, نوامبر
Anonim
اندازه گیری الکتریسیته ساکن سیستم روشنایی اورژانس
اندازه گیری الکتریسیته ساکن سیستم روشنایی اورژانس
اندازه گیری الکتریسیته ساکن سیستم روشنایی اورژانس
اندازه گیری الکتریسیته ساکن سیستم روشنایی اورژانس

آیا تا به حال به این فکر کرده اید که وقتی برق اصلی شما قطع می شود ، یک سیستم روشنایی اضطراری بسازید. و از آنجا که شما حتی اطلاعات کمی در زمینه الکترونیک دارید ، باید بدانید که به سادگی می توانید با اندازه گیری ولتاژ در دسترس بودن منبع تغذیه را بررسی کنید.

اما آنچه می خواهم بگویم رویکرد کاملاً متفاوتی است. من پیشنهاد می کنم که برای اندازه گیری شدت میدان الکترواستاتیک در نزدیکی سیم اصلی تغذیه و فیلتر کردن آن و خواندن و استفاده از آن طبق استفاده ما. مزیت این روش این است که ما به طور کامل از قدرت اصلی جدا شده ایم و می توانم بگویم غیر تهاجمی (حتی شما از یک عایق نوری که برای برق رسانی به آن نیاز دارید) این پروژه شامل 3 قسمت اصلی است ،

  • سنسور الکتریسیته ساکن
  • پردازنده سیگنال مبتنی بر فیلتر kalman
  • کنترل کننده نور مبتنی بر رله

مرحله 1: سنسور الکتریسیته ساکن

سنسور الکتریسیته ساکن
سنسور الکتریسیته ساکن
سنسور الکتریسیته ساکن
سنسور الکتریسیته ساکن

بچه ها ، این ساده ترین سنسور الکتریسیته ساکن موجود است. این فقط یک جفت ترانزیستور است.

  • من از 2 ترانزیستور C828 NPN استفاده کردم اما هر 2 ترانزیستور NPN عمومی کار را انجام می دهد.
  • به دلیل افزایش شدید جفت دارلیگتون ، می توانیم تغییر الکتریسیته ساکن را در نقطه ورودی اندازه گیری کنیم.
  • فقط از یک نوار چسب استفاده کنید و پین ورودی را با عایق برق اصلی چسبانید.

یک سیم AC 230V به چراغ اتاق من می رود و من فقط یک سیم از جفت دارلیگتون را به محفظه وصل کننده آن سیم منتقل کردم.

مرحله 2: پردازش سیگنال با استفاده از آردوینو

پردازش سیگنال با استفاده از آردوینو
پردازش سیگنال با استفاده از آردوینو

من برای این کار از نانو آردوینو استفاده کردم. اما از هر نوع آردوینو می توان استفاده کرد.

اساساً در اینجا قرائت ولتاژ از سنسور الکتریکی استاتیک پردازش می شود و در انتهای سند کد را توضیح می دهم.

سپس پین دیجیتال 9 متناسب با آن تغییر می کند تا نور اضطراری از طریق رله کنترل شود

مرحله 3: مدار کامل

مدار کامل
مدار کامل

رله توسط یک ترانزیستور قدرت هدایت می شود و یک دیود جانبدار معکوس وجود دارد تا از آسیب دیدن ترانزیستور توسط ولتاژ ناشی از معکوس سیم پیچ رله جلوگیری شود.

با خیال راحت سیم کشی رله را تغییر دهید و یک لامپ با هر ولتاژ داشته باشید.

مرحله 4: توضیح کد

در این کد من 2 فیلتر kalman آبشار را اجرا کرده ام. من این الگوریتم را با مشاهده خروجی در هر مرحله ساختم و توسعه دادم تا خروجی مورد نظر را داشته باشد.

مرحله 5: شیء کالمن

شیء کالمن
شیء کالمن
شیء کالمن
شیء کالمن

در اینجا من یک کلاس برای فیلتر kalman ایجاد کرده ام. شامل همه متغیرهای لازم در اینجا من نمی خواهم مفاهیم متغیرها را به تفصیل توضیح دهم ، همانطور که در سایت های دیگر می توانید پیدا کنید. نوع داده "دو" برای مدیریت ریاضی مورد نیاز مناسب است.

مقدار 'R' را با ردیابی و خطا با مشاهده خروجی فیلتر 1 قرار می دهم ، آن را افزایش می دهم تا جایی که در تصویر دوم نشان داده می شود صدای بدون نویز دریافت می کنم. مقدار 'Q' برای همه فیلترهای kalman 1D کلی است. یافتن ارزش مناسب برای این کار یک نوع کار خسته کننده است ، بنابراین بهتر است ساده کار کنیم

مرحله 6: Kalman Object و Setup

شیء Kalman و راه اندازی
شیء Kalman و راه اندازی
  • در اینجا فیلتر kalman پیاده سازی شده است
  • 2 جسم از آن تشکیل شد
  • pinModes برای دریافت داده ها و خروجی سیگنال رله تنظیم شده است

مرحله 7: حلقه

حلقه
حلقه
حلقه
حلقه

ابتدا سیگنال ورودی را فیلتر کردم ، سپس مشاهده کردم که وقتی منبع تغذیه AC هنگام غیاب وجود داشته باشد ، چه اتفاقی می افتد.

وقتی وصل می کنم متوجه تغییر واریانس می شوم.

بنابراین من 2 مقدار متوالی خروجی فیلتر را کم کردم و آن را به عنوان واریانس در نظر گرفتم.

سپس مشاهده کردم که هنگام روشن و خاموش کردن شبکه چه اتفاقی برای آن می افتد. متوجه شدم که هنگام تعویض تغییرات قابل توجهی اتفاق می افتد. اما مسئله این بود که ارزشها به طور قابل توجهی در نوسان است. این را می توان با استفاده از میانگین حل شده حل کرد. اما از آنجا که قبلاً از کالمن استفاده کردم ، فقط یک بلوک فیلتر دیگر را به واریانس متصل کردم و خروجی ها را مقایسه کردم.

توصیه شده: